Indigenous leader Warren Mundine has suggested imposing a 'Trump-style anti-Australian tax' on a major foreign-owned hospitality company that has continued to snub Australia Day celebrations despite issuing an apology following public backlash.

Indigenous leader Warren Mundine has suggested implementing a"Trump-style anti-Australian tax" on the pub group which has continued to distance itself from Australia Day despite issuing an apology following backlash over its ban on celebrations on the national holiday.in 2025 over"sadness" and"hurt" the public holiday can cause.its venues did the company, based in Melbourne, apologise to Australians.

“It is not for us to tell anyone whether or how to celebrate Australia Day. We acknowledge that and we apologise for our comments. It certainly wasn’t our intention to offend anyone.” The Hong Kong-owned pub group told managers Australia Day celebrations were banned at more than 200 pubs and bars across the country. Picture: Australian Venue Co/Boomerang Hotel

Indigenous leader Warren Mundine said the pubs and restaurants in question, while owned by a foreign entity, were"happy to take our money and look down their noses at us"."Dress up in the Australian flag and sing our national anthem and have a barbie at home instead pubs.At the time of the initial ban, Mr Mundine called to “stop all this nonsense” and to “stop banning events”.

Murray pointed out the hypocrisy of the company which would likely continue to operate pokie machines and serve alcohol.
